VARNAVA, George
MOVEMENT OF SOCIAL DEMOCRATS EDEK (KS EDEK)
Personal info:
Place of origin and date of birth:
Famagusta (occupied by Turkish troops), 13 September 1968.
Marital status:
Married to Stella Efstathiou Papamiltiadous; has two daughters and one son.
Studies:
Russian and English Literature and MA in Education (The Pyatigorsk State Pedagogical Institute of Foreign Languages, Russia).
Profession:
Teacher.
Foreign languages:
English, Russian.
Parliamentary tenure / activity:
Representative of Famagusta constituency under the banner of the Social Democratic Movement (KISOS) 2001-2003 and under the banner of the KS EDEK since 2003.
Is:
Spokesman of the KS EDEK group in the House.
Member of the Committee of Selection.
Chairman of the House Standing Committee on Defence Affairs.
Member of the House Standing Committee on Educational Affairs, of the House Standing Committee on Refugees-Enclaved-Missing-Adversely Affected Persons, of the House Standing Committee on Trade and Industry and deputy member of the Special House Committee on Declaration and Examination of Financial Interests.
Member of the delegation of the House to the Inter-Parliamentary Union (IPU) and of the delegation of the House to the Interparliamentary Assembly on Orthodoxy (IAO).
Member of the delegation of the House to the Interparliamentary Conference for the Common Foreign and Security Policy (CFSP) and the Common Security and Defense Policy (CSDP).
Political career:
Famagusta District Secretary of the Socialist Youth Organisation EDEN (SN EDEN) (1997-2000).
Member of the Central Council of the SN EDEN, then of the Social Democratic Youth (NEOS).
Observer to the European Parliament (2003-2004) and member of the Political Group and of the Political Bureau of the European People’s Party.
Member of the Foreign Affairs Committee of the European Parliament
(2003-2004).
President of the Famagusta District Committee of KISOS/KS EDEK
(2000-2008).
Member of the KS EDEK Central Committee and of the KS EDEK Political Bureau.
